Accessing & Creating Local Content
Barb Ciambor, RRLC Outreach Librarian, will provide a guided tour of the New York Heritage Digital Collections and Historical Newspapers of the Rochester, New York Region databases.
NY Heritage Digital Collections, a project of the NY3Rs Association, Inc. provides the public with free access to digital collections of historical and cultural interest. NewYorkHeritage.org is a research portal for students, educators, historians, genealogists and others who are interested in learning more about the people, places and institutions of historical New York State. The site provides immediate free access to more than 160 distinct digital collections that reflect New York State's long history. These collections represent a broad range of historical, scholarly and cultural materials that are held in libraries, museums and archives throughout the state. Collection items include photographs, letters, diaries, directories, maps, newspapers, books and more.
Historical Newspapers of the Rochester, NY Region provides indexed access to selected historical newspapers from the service area of the Rochester Regional Library Council: Livingston, Monroe, Ontario, Wayne and Wyoming counties. The content is limited to microfilmed newspapers. Currently included are newspapers from Brockport, Geneva, Canandaigua, Fairport and Newark and a run of the Catholic Courier.
